Given Professor Pant’s background, the book offers an invaluable perspective on India’s evolving role on the world stage. It tracks India's transition from the principles of Non-Alignment (NAM) to a strategy of "Multi-Alignment," where New Delhi actively engages with competing power centers (e.g., maintaining robust ties with both the US and Russia) to protect its strategic autonomy. Professor Pant breaks down the complex web of global interactions into structured, understandable concepts. The book primarily focuses on the transition from the bipolar Cold War era to the fragmented, multipolar world of the 21st century.
